body { 
	padding-top:25px;
	padding-right:0px;
	padding-bottom:0px;
	padding-left:0px; 
	margin:0px; 
	font-family:Arial; 
	font-size:11px;}


a:link    {color:#797A7B;font-weight:bold;text-decoration:none;}
a:visited {color:#797A7B;font-weight:bold;text-decoration:none;}
a:hover   {color:#797A7B;font-weight:bold;text-decoration:underline;}
a:active  {color:#797A7B;font-weight:bold;text-decoration:none;}

div.div_lastUpdate {
	position:absolute;
	top:120px;
	left:0px; 
	width:1024px;
	height:14px;
	background-color:#FDDFBF;
	text-indent:30px;
}

div.div_slideapplet {
	position:absolute;
	top:134px;
	left:0px;  
	width:1024px;
	height:291px;
}



div.div_underApplet {
	position:absolute;
	top:425px;
	left:0px;  
	width:1024px;
	height:5px;
	background-color:#FDDFBF;
}
div.div_aboveMainMenu {
	position:absolute;
	top:425px;
	left:0px;  
	width:265px;
	height:5px;
	background-color:#FDDFBF;
}

div.div_blueVerticalLine {
	position:absolute; 
	background-color: #a5dadb;
	top:134px; 
	left:238px; 
	height:291px; 
	width: 27px; 
	border:0px solid #000;
}
div.div_newproduct_frame_small {
	position:absolute;
	top:430px;
	left:785px;
	width:240px;
	height:350px;
	border:0px solid #000;
	background-color:#D9DADB;
	overflow-x:hidden;
	overflow-y:auto;
}

div.div_newproduct_frame {
	position:absolute;
	top:134px;
	left:785px;
	width:240px;
	height:646px;
	border:0px solid #000;
	background-color:#D9DADB;
	overflow-x:hidden;
	overflow-y:auto;
}

.td_news_header {
	color:#E85153;
	font-size:20px;
	font-weight:bold;
	font-style:italic;
	text-decoration:blink;
}
.td_news_series {
	border:0px solid #000;
	color:#000;
	font-size:11px;
	font-style:italic;
}

.span_news_modelname {
	background-color:#7F3C8C;
	color:#FFF;
	font-style:normal;
	font-size:12px;
	font-weight:bold;
	padding-right:8px;
	padding-left:8px;
}

.td_news_contents {
	color:#000;
	font-size:10px;
}

.td_news_link {
	color:#E85153;
	font-size:11px;
	font-weight:bold;
	font-style:italic
}

.img_news_thumbs {
	float: right;
}

div.div_header {
	position:absolute;
	top:25px;
	left:0px;
	width:1024px;
	height:95px;
}

div.div_footer {
	position:absolute;
	top:775px;
	left:000px;
	width:1024px;
	height:22px;
	text-align:center;
}

div.div_index_content {
	position:absolute;
	top:430px;
	left:265px;
	width:470px;
	height:300px;
	border:0px solid #000;
	padding-top:25px;
	padding-left:25px;
	font-size:12px;
	overflow:auto;
}
div.div_index_content h1{
	font-size:15px;
	font-weight:bold;
}

div.div_impressum_content {
	position:absolute;
	top:134px;
	left:265px;
	width:470px;
	height:596px;
	border:0px solid #000;
	padding-top:25px;
	padding-left:25px;
	font-size:11px;
	overflow:auto;
}
div.div_impressum_content h1{
	font-size:15px;
	font-weight:bold;
}

div.div_impressum_content a:link    {color:black;font-weight:normal;text-decoration:none;}
div.div_impressum_content a:visited {color:black;font-weight:normal;text-decoration:none;}
div.div_impressum_content a:hover   {color:black;font-weight:normal;text-decoration:underline;}
div.div_impressum_content a:active  {color:black;font-weight:normal;text-decoration:none;}

div.div_agb_content {
	position:absolute;
	top:134px;
	left:265px;
	width:470px;
	height:596px;
	border:0px solid #000;
	padding-top:25px;
	padding-left:25px;
	font-size:11px;
	overflow:auto;
}
div.div_agb_content h1{
	font-size:15px;
	font-weight:bold;
}

div.div_agb_content a:link    {color:black;font-weight:normal;text-decoration:none;}
div.div_agb_content a:visited {color:black;font-weight:normal;text-decoration:none;}
div.div_agb_content a:hover   {color:black;font-weight:normal;text-decoration:underline;}
div.div_agb_content a:active  {color:black;font-weight:normal;text-decoration:none;}

div.div_sitemap_content {
	position:absolute;
	top:134px;
	left:265px;
	width:470px;
	height:596px;
	border:0px solid #000;
	padding-top:25px;
	padding-left:25px;
	font-size:14px;
	overflow:auto;
}
div.div_sitemap_content h1{
	font-size:15px;
	font-weight:bold;
}

div.div_sitemap_content a:link    {color:black;font-weight:normal;text-decoration:none;}
div.div_sitemap_content a:visited {color:black;font-weight:normal;text-decoration:none;}
div.div_sitemap_content a:hover   {color:black;font-weight:normal;text-decoration:underline;}
div.div_sitemap_content a:active  {color:black;font-weight:normal;text-decoration:none;}
div.div_sitemap_content ul {list-style-type:none;font-weight:bold;}
div.div_sitemap_content li {list-style-type:none;font-weight:normal;text-indent:10px}

div.div_news_menuframe {
	position:absolute;
	top:164px;
	left:30px;  
	width:190px;
	height:261px;
	text-align:right;
	font-size:14px;
}



div.div_news_contents {
	position:absolute;
	top:134px;
	left:265px;
	width:520px;
	height:596px;
	border:0px solid #000;
	padding-top:10px;
	padding-left:10px;
	font-size:14px;
	overflow:auto;
}

.div_news_contents a:link    {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_news_contents a:visited {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_news_contents a:hover   {color:#016DB5;font-weight:bold;text-decoration:underline;}
.div_news_contents a:active  {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_news_contents ul 		 {list-style-type:none;font-weight:bold;}
.div_news_contents li 		 {list-style-type:none;font-weight:normal;text-indent:10px}

div.div_event_contents {
	position:absolute;
	top:134px;
	left:265px;
	width:510px;
	height:596px;
	border:0px solid #000;
	padding-top:10px;
	padding-left:10px;
	font-size:12px;
	overflow:auto;
}

.div_event_contents a:link    {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_event_contents a:visited {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_event_contents a:hover   {color:#016DB5;font-weight:bold;text-decoration:underline;}
.div_event_contents a:active  {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_event_contents ul 		 {list-style-type:none;font-weight:bold;}
.div_event_contents li 		 {list-style-type:none;font-weight:normal;text-indent:10px}
.div_event_contents h1 		 {font-size:15px;font-weight:bold;}


div.div_press_content {
	position:absolute;
	top:134px;
	left:265px;
	width:510px;
	height:596px;
	border:0px solid #000;
	padding-top:10px;
	padding-left:10px;
	font-size:14px;
	overflow:auto;
}

.div_press_content a:link    {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_press_content a:visited {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_press_content a:hover   {color:#016DB5;font-weight:bold;text-decoration:underline;}
.div_press_content a:active  {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_press_content ul 		 {list-style-type:none;font-weight:bold;}
.div_press_content li 		 {list-style-type:none;font-weight:normal;text-indent:10px}

.div_press_content h1 		 {font-size:15px;font-weight:bold;}
.div_press_content h2 		 {font-size:15px;font-weight:bold;}

div.div_unternehmen_menuframe {
	position:absolute;
	top:164px;
	left:30px;  
	width:190px;
	height:261px;
	text-align:right;
	font-size:14px;
}



div.div_unternehmen_content {
	position:absolute;
	top:134px;
	left:265px;
	width:490px;
	height:596px;
	border:0px solid #000;
	padding-top:20px;
	padding-left:20px;
	font-size:12px;
	overflow:auto;
}

.div_unternehmen_content a:link    {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_unternehmen_content a:visited {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_unternehmen_content a:hover   {color:#016DB5;font-weight:bold;text-decoration:underline;}
.div_unternehmen_content a:active  {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_unternehmen_content ul 		 {list-style-type:none;font-weight:bold;}
.div_unternehmen_content li 		 {list-style-type:none;font-weight:normal;text-indent:10px}
div.div_unternehmen_content h1{
	font-size:15px;
	font-weight:bold;
}

div.div_contact_menuframe {
	position:absolute;
	top:164px;
	left:30px;  
	width:190px;
	height:261px;
	text-align:right;
	font-size:14px;
}




div.div_contact_content {
	position:absolute;
	top:134px;
	left:265px;
	width:430px;
	height:596px;
	border:0px solid #000;
	padding-top:20px;
	padding-left:50px;
	font-size:12px;
	overflow-x:hidden;
	overflow-y:auto;
}

.div_contact_content a:link    {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_contact_content a:visited {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_contact_content a:hover   {color:#016DB5;font-weight:bold;text-decoration:underline;}
.div_contact_content a:active  {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_contact_content ul 		 {list-style-type:none;font-weight:bold;}
.div_contact_content li 		 {list-style-type:none;font-weight:normal;text-indent:10px}
div.div_contact_content h1{
	font-size:13px;
	font-weight:bold;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
}

div.div_contact_content h2{
	font-size:12px;
	color:red;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
}

.contact_textbox {
	width:90%;
	border:1px solid #aaa;
}
.contact_textbox_error {
	width:90%;
	border:1px solid #faa;
}
.contact_textarea {width:92%; height:100px;}



img.img_offices_thumb {
	float:right;
	padding-top:10px;
	margin-right:20px;
}


div.div_product_menuframe {
	position:absolute;
	top:164px;
	left:30px;  
	width:190px;
	height:261px;
	text-align:right;
	font-size:14px;
}



div.div_product_content {
	position:absolute;
	top:134px;
	left:270px;
	width:490px;
	height:596px;
	border:0px solid #000;
	padding-top:20px;
	padding-left:20px;
	font-size:12px;
	overflow-y:auto;
	overflow-x:hidden;
	background-image:url(img/products/bg_products.jpg);
	background-repeat:no-repeat;
	background-attachment: scroll;
}

.div_product_content a:link    {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_product_content a:visited {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_product_content a:hover   {color:#016DB5;font-weight:bold;text-decoration:underline;}
.div_product_content a:active  {color:#016DB5;font-weight:bold;text-decoration:none;}
.div_product_content ul 		 {list-style-type:none;font-weight:bold;}
.div_product_content li 		 {list-style-type:none;font-weight:normal;text-indent:10px}
div.div_product_content h1{
	font-size:15px;
	font-weight:bold;
}
div.div_product_content h2{
	color:white;
	font-size:16pt;
	font-weight:normal;
	position:absolute;
	top:0px;
	left:20px;
}

div.div_product_specs {
	font-weight:normal;
	position:absolute;
	top:260px;
	left:20px;
	width:490px;
	font-size:12px;
}



##div.div_product_content img{
##	position:absolute;
##	top:80px;
##	left:200px;
##	float: right;
##}
div.div_product_content span{
	position:absolute;
	top:80px;
	left:200px;
	float: right;
}

div.div_product_list {
	position:absolute;
	top:134px;
	left:785px;
	width:240px;
	height:646px;
	border:0px solid #000;
	background-color:#D9DADB;
	overflow-x:hidden;
	overflow-y:auto;
}

div.div_product_list img {
	background-color:#b7bab3;
}


